分布式航电系统探讨与分析

摘    要:航电系统作为飞机的"大脑"和"神经中枢",主要完成与飞行任务相关的功能,在机载系统中占有重要地位。探讨了航电系统从分离式结构到联合式结构再到现在普遍应用的IMA结构的发展历程;分析了分布式航电系统发展到现今阶段所应用的关键技术,如维护技术、网络、操作系统、中间件、系统开发方法及支撑工具等;展望了分布式航电系统的发展趋势:它将会进一步提高综合化程度,引入人工智能、模式识别及传感器系统综合等高端技术,向着跨平台、智能化、网络化的方向发展。

Exploration and Analysis of Distributed Avionics

Abstract:As the brain and the nerve center of the plane ,Avinoics mainly complete the flight mission re-lated function ,occupy an important position in the airborne systems ,and play a key role .The progress of the Avionics are discussed from the seprated structure to joint structure and the IMA structure now in gen -eral use.Then the key technologies of the distributed Avionics are analyzed ,such as maintenance technol-ogy,network,operating system,middleware,system development method,and the technical support tools, etc.In the end,the development trend of distributed avionics is prospected ,it will further improve the de-gree of integration,and will go on developing in the crossed-platform,intelligent and networked direction , by importing high-end technologies such as artificial intelligence ,mode recognition and integrated sensor system .
